Cloverport was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ss. They came up short against the Meade County Green Waves, falling 3-0.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Green Waves this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 3-0 back in August.
The final score came out to 25-7, 25-2, 25-8.
Cloverport's defeat dropped their record down to 0-10-1. As for Meade County, they are on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 9-7 record this season.
Cloverport did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 3-0 loss against Hancock County on the 9th. As for Meade County,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 3-2 victory against Green County on the 9th.
